Understanding Custom Homes?

Custom homes are homes that are designed and built from the ground up according to the specific preferences of the homeowner. Unlike production homes, where construction firms select floor plans in advance and repeat them across multiple of units, custom homes open with your priorities.

The scope covers collaborating with a design team to create custom blueprints that suit your land, your lifestyle needs, and your aesthetic preferences. After that, a licensed builder like Brother & Brother Builders oversees all the trades — framers, plumbers, finish carpenters — to transform those plans to reality.

Custom homes also give owners full decision-making power over materials. Clients decide on everything from the foundation type to the door knobs. This degree of control is the reason custom homes worth the investment for families with particular needs and standards.

Inside the Custom Homes Process Works: Step by Step

  1. Initial Consultation and Vision Discovery — It all kicks off with a detailed conversation where our team listens carefully. We explore your budget expectations, space requirements, property limitations, and aesthetic priorities before a single line is drafted.
  2. Site Evaluation and Feasibility Review — Before any blueprints are created, our team perform a careful lot assessment. The process covers soil conditions, zoning restrictions, and municipal regulations that will shape what can be built.
  3. Drafting the Plans — In collaboration with licensed architects, we develop detailed construction drawings built to your specifications. Clients review multiple design iterations and suggest revisions until every detail is exactly what you want.
  4. City Review and Permit Filing — Brother & Brother Builders oversees every submission with San Jose building authorities. This stage includes structural engineering reviews so that the full project is organized before the first shovel hits the dirt.
  5. Active Construction Phase — After the green light is given, building starts. Our project managers maintain constant oversight to ensure quality meets our standards. You are given routine status reports throughout this phase.
  6. Choosing Your Finishes — Once the shell is complete, homeowners lock in countertop materials, tile choices, and trim profiles. Our team coordinates all finish subcontractors to hold the schedule moving efficiently.
  7. Move-In Readiness Review — Before you receive the title, your project manager leads a thorough walkthrough of every area and system. Every detail not meeting your approval are resolved before closing, and we provide a hands-on tutorial on your home's systems and features.

Custom Homes FAQ

How long does it take to build a custom home?

A typical custom build in San Jose requires somewhere between 12 and 24 months start to finish, depending on design complexity and local approval schedules. City review alone can take several months in densely regulated markets, so beginning the here process with plenty of lead time is essential.

What does a custom home cost in San Jose?

Building budgets for custom homes in the area generally fall between $450 to $650 per square foot excluding land, based on design complexity. High-end finishes and unusual lot constraints can add to that range. A detailed estimate is prepared following the design and engineering phase.

Can I make changes during construction?

Modifications requested mid-build are possible but should be approached carefully. Revisions made before framing begins are far less costly than revisions needed after systems are installed. Our team advises clients on the cost and schedule impact of all proposed revisions before moving forward.

How do I know if I need a fully custom home versus a semi-custom option?

Semi-custom construction is based on a pre-designed floor plan that clients can adjust within set parameters. A genuinely custom home begin from scratch, allowing the buyer complete design latitude on every aspect of the design, engineering, and aesthetic. For buyers with a strong creative vision, a true custom build produces the outcome they need.
